Lord, when trespassing thoughts threaten to plunge me into despair, it is Your mighty arm that grabs hold of my soul in peace. Forgive Your beloved for the careless retreat and vain distractions that move my heart away from You until only Your divine fingertips are touching it. Lord Jesus, restore me to the full grip that encircles my weary heart with the entirety of Your hand. My heart is Yours. I belong to You. There is no cloud too dark that You cannot illuminate it with light. For even the clouds have the necessary purpose of bringing rain to parched soil. Let the storms rage around me. I will not be afraid because Your presence is my comfort. Thank You God for dispelling the anguish of loneliness that confuses my heart with a distortion of unworthiness. The life You have shown me testified to Your worth. Let Your beloved be a reflection of all that You are. Make every beat of my heart a worship, every breath a praise to my King. In the depths with You is where I always want to be, Jesus. Under the Word of truth graciously given in Psalm 42:1-3, 5 and the authority of Christ, I pray.
As a deer pants for flowing streams,
so pants my soul for You, O God.
My soul thirsts for God,
for the living God.
When shall I come and appear before God?
My tears have been my food
day and night.
Why are you cast down, O my soul,
and why are you in turmoil within me?
Hope in God; for I shall again praise Him,
my salvation and my God.
Psalm 42:1-3, 5
